              PC Gamers PSA

              Worth keeping an eye on, in the US Dead Space is marked down to be available for unlimited play via EA Play Pro when it releases on the 27 Jan. Assuming that it's available in the UK the same way as well that will mean you can pay for one month's subscription at £14.99 to play the game and even rattle through Need for Speed: Unbound as well making it the cheapest way to play the game on release
